Gwang Il Jang is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Ecology and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Gwang Il Jang has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 307 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Molecular Biology, 14 papers in Ecology and 6 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Gwang Il Jang’s work include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(14 papers), Microbial Community Ecology and Physiology (12 papers) and Aquaculture disease management and microbiota (5 papers). Gwang Il Jang is often cited by papers focused on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(14 papers), Microbial Community Ecology and Physiology (12 papers) and Aquaculture disease management and microbiota (5 papers). Gwang Il Jang collaborates with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Vietnam. Gwang Il Jang's co-authors include Byung Cheol Cho, Chung Yeon Hwang, Stephen C. Hardies, Byung C. Cho, Won Sang Lee, Sukyoung Yun, Craig Stevens, SungHyun Nam, Jae Hoon Noh and Hyunwoo Chung and has published in prestigious journ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, Journal of Virology and Atmospheric Environment.
